Posted by John McHaleMUNICH, Germany, 13 Oct. 2010. Session topics for the 2011 Avionics Europe conference and exhibition to be held March 16 to 17, 2011 in Munich were selected today by the conference advisory board. Leading off the conference will be a session on Single Europe Sky (SES) and Future Avionics Systems followed by a session titled Current Air Traffic Management (ATM)/Avionics Realities. The first day will close with Session 3, a panel discussion titled Integrating New Avionics into Airplanes in a Down Economy. Panelists will include representatives from KLM Royal Dutch Airlines, Airbus, Rockwell Collins, and Honeywell Aerospace. Sessions slated for day 2 of the conference – March 17 – begin with Session 4: Avionics Market and Traffic Forecasts, followed by Session 5: Helicopter Avionics Modernization. The final session, held after lunch, will be EFBs (Electronic Flight Bags) and Avionics Systems Certification Challenges. For more information on the event, visit www.avionics-event.com.
